A number of potential challengers for Tom Perriello's seat have come forward or are encouraging discussion.

Laurence P. Verga is a real estate investor who moved to the area from Pebble Beach, California five years ago. He announced yesterday that he has formally filed with the FEC. He has never run for public office before, and says he bases his desire to run on opposition to the Obama administration, particularly what he sees as "runaway" spending which engenders "irresponsible debt." In a recent interview, Verga said “Obama doesn’t want to improve the economy. He wants to keep it like it is so he can expand the federal government.”

He advocates advancing toward energy independence through development of traditional sources--"drill now and drill here." All social benefits will be achieved through lower taxes. Life begins at conception. And he will defend our second amendment rights. He has been quoted as saying, “I’m very, very conservative, I’m not trying to be middle-of-the-road at all.”

Federal Election Commission records show donations by Verga and his wife of about $9,000 to the RNC and Republican candidates in the past six years. He is married, and has four young children. Verga suffers from polycystic kidney disease, and is awaiting a kidney transplant.
